Feeling a bit unwell from the heat today and took a few hours off. Reflecting on how not a lot of people, including myself, have that option when needed.
When I was a full time employee, one of the worst parts of getting sick wasn’t the illness itself—it was being forced to go to a doctor or chemist to get a note justifying my absence. I’d spend what little money I had when I should have been in bed recovering, and every part of it screamed one thing: They don’t care about me or trust me. It felt dehumanizing.
For me, this goes deeper than just being sick. I’m a gay man living with PTSD, anxiety, and depression. I shouldn’t have to tell everyone I meet that I was sexually abused as a minor—multiple times—but experiences like that affect how you see the world. They affect how you experience work environments where trust, empathy, and basic kindness are absent.
Employers demanded I show up to work but not with my health struggles, mental or physical. They wanted me there, but only on impossible terms—terms that ignored my reality.
Now that I’m self-employed, I have the freedom to prioritize my health without jumping through hoops. But the truth is, those past experiences still affect my long-term health. And it’s frustrating to know that so many people are still stuck in systems like this, where empathy takes a backseat to control. Even government jobs will demand sick notes of their employees, regardless of the impact of obtaining one will have on their health.
We can—and must—do better. Trust your employees, and co-workers. Let them take the time they need to recover without judgement. Stop treating sick leave as a privilege to be earned and start seeing it for what it is: a basic human right that goes beyond the concerns of work.
